Cloning and nucleotide sequence of the Brucella abortus groE operon.

D Gor1, J E Mayfield.   

Abstract

The cloning and sequencing of the Brucella abortus groES and groEL genes are reported. The genes are adjacent on the Brucella chromosome, and presumably comprise a functional operon. Putative promoter and terminator sequences are also identified. The groES gene exhibits 60%, and the groEl gene 69%, sequence identity with the corresponding Escherichia coli genes.
